NVIDIA Add-in Board Partners Announce GeForce GTX 780 Graphics Cards

NVIDIA has just announced its new GeForce GTX 780 GPU and its add-in board partners have wasted no time in getting their own takes on the new GPU out in the market.

NVIDIA has just introduced its latest GPU - the GeForce GTX 780. The new GPU has the same GK110 chip as seen in the range-topping GeForce GTX Titan, but has been pared down to only have 2304 CUDA cores, thanks to disabling of two SMX units.

Nevertheless, it still remains to be a powerful card and NVIDIA says it will offer substantial performance improvements over the older GeForce GTX 680. The GeForce GTX Titan remains as NVIDIA's flagship. You can find out more in our full review here.
